The Pittsburgh Steelers have signed wide receiver Antonio Brown to a five-year extension that will keep him with the team through the 2017 season. Terms of the new deal announced Friday were not disclosed.|||||||
Brown, set to begin his third year in the league, was selected by Pittsburgh in the sixth round of the 2010 draft. He has totaled 85 receptions for 1,275 yards with two touchdowns in two seasons with the Steelers. Last year, he was second on the team with 69 receptions for 1,108 yards and and also had 1,062 return yards, becoming the first player in NFL history with 1,000 yards in both. He also earned a trip to the Pro Bowl as a kick returner.
Brown had six receptions for 90 yards as Pittsburgh hobbled into the postseason with a wind-whipped 13-9 win Sunday over Cleveland.|||||||
Brown was 15th in the NFL with 1,108 yards through the air.
In his second career start, Brown had a career-high 151 yards and scored the clinching touchdown in a 14-3 victory over Cleveland on Thursday night.|||||||
Most of Brown's yards came on that 79-yard score from Ben Roethlisberger with 2:42 remaining. He has 663 of his 925 yards over the last seven games.
